Output f90259d41ac4c83633b9934e208bcea815a49291160d3e8ea23fb110cd9eab76:0

value
160368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 180b9dc38bf784a1d788d5988ec2489479178a0a OP_EQUAL
address
33tA4G2f3o6cBDAmkNAj1zgtHbEZba1o6u
transaction
f90259d41ac4c83633b9934e208bcea815a49291160d3e8ea23fb110cd9eab76
confirmations
331778
spent
true